The book begins with a discussion of the East India Company's rise to power in India and the subsequent establishment of British rule. It then examines the Indian independence movement, the partition of India, and the early years of the post-independence era.

The book also explores the economic and social changes that have taken place in India since independence. It discusses the country's rapid economic growth in recent decades, as well as the challenges it faces, such as poverty, inequality, and environmental degradation.
